Vigabatrin: Understanding Its Anticonvulsant Properties and Applications
Vigabatrin, identified by CAS 60643-86-9, is a significant pharmaceutical intermediate renowned for its potent anticonvulsant properties. Its therapeutic efficacy stems from its role as a selective, irreversible inhibitor of gamma-aminobutyric acid transaminase (GABA-T). By blocking this enzyme, Vigabatrin enhances the availability of GABA, the brain's primary inhibitory neurotransmitter, thereby reducing neuronal excitability and mitigating seizure activity. This mechanism makes it a vital compound for research and clinical applications targeting epilepsy.

The applications of Vigabatrin are primarily focused on treating specific forms of epilepsy, such as refractory complex partial seizures and infantile spasms, where other treatments have proven insufficient. Its ability to modulate GABAergic neurotransmission makes it a cornerstone in epilepsy research and treatment development.
